If you’re curious about nervous system regulation and how it can help you, then you’ve come to the right place. In today’s episode, we have guest experts Lola Pickett, Shelby Lee, Jen Underwood, Renee Reese, Christa Bevan, and Dr. Lee Cordell share with us what this concept really means and how we can apply this in our personal and professional lives. We are peeling back the curtain to go in depth into why you should know about this and why it matters. Listen in!

Key Quotes:
“As with anything, it starts with you, and I love to tell people that the biggest violator of your boundaries isn't somebody else, it's you.” - Lola Pickett
“And so we have to remember, or even learn for the first time how to be in connection and present with another. So that we can start letting our systems regulate.” - Shelby Lee
“As with any kind of trauma work or embodiment work, if we don't bring our minds in, we can't really regulate our bodies.” - Jen Underwood
“Nervous system regulation is the idea of living your life from a home base of feeling calm and safe and able to connect with others and not feeling dysregulated.” - Christa Bevan
